> Have you checked whether this can be used by usb-storage?
> In that case you would need to use GFP_NOIO.

Thanks for the heads-up.  If I read the code correctly, it isn't used
by usb-storage.  If I'm wrong or that's likely to change, I'd be happy
with GFP_NOIO.
